제조 AI - Machinable Language란?

박종영

Machinable Language의 정의

핵심 정의

Machinable Language기계(AI/AI Agent)가 직접 읽고, 이해하고, 추론하고, 실행할 수 있도록 구조화된 데이터 표현 체계를 의미합니다.

 


상세 정의

Machinable Language는 다음 4가지 특성을 모두 충족하는 데이터 언어입니다:

1. Machine-Readable (기계 판독 가능)

  • 구조화된 형식 (JSON, XML, RDF, OWL 등)
  • 파싱 가능한 문법
  • 표준화된 스키마

2. Machine-Understandable (기계 이해 가능)

  • 명시적 의미론 (Explicit Semantics)
  • 온톨로지 기반 개념 정의
  • 데이터 간 관계 명시 (인과관계, 계층관계, 의존관계)

3. Machine-Inferable (기계 추론 가능)

  • 논리적 추론 규칙 포함
  • 인과관계 그래프
  • 예측 및 최적화 가능한 구조

4. Machine-Executable (기계 실행 가능)

  • 즉시 행동으로 전환 가능한 지시
  • API 호출, 작업 지시, 의사결정 트리거
  • 자동화 워크플로우 생성

기존 개념과의 차이

개념설명Machinable Language와의 차이
Machine-Readable Data기계가 읽을 수 있는 형식 (CSV, JSON 등)읽기만 가능, 의미 이해 불가
Structured Data구조화된 데이터 (데이터베이스 등)구조만 있음, 실행 불가
Semantic Web의미론적 웹 데이터 (RDF, OWL)의미는 있으나 실행 지향 아님
Ontology개념과 관계의 형식적 표현지식 표현에 집중, 행동 지시 부족
Machinable Language읽기+이해+추론+실행 모두 가능종합적 실행 가능 언어

구성 요소

Machinable Language는 다음을 포함합니다:

1. 의미 계층 (Semantic Layer)
   - 데이터의 의미 정의
   - 온톨로지 기반 개념 체계
2. 관계 계층 (Relationship Layer)
   - 인과관계 (A causes B)
   - 시간관계 (A precedes B)
   - 계층관계 (A is part of B)
3. 추론 계층 (Inference Layer)
   - 논리 규칙
   - 예측 모델
   - 최적화 알고리즘
4. 실행 계층 (Execution Layer)
   - 액션 템플릿
   - 워크플로우 정의
   - API 바인딩

간단한 비유

Human Language (사람의 언어)

  • 목적: 사람 간 의사소통
  • 특징: 맥락 의존적, 암묵적 의미, 해석 필요
  • 예: "온도가 좀 높네요. 확인 좀 부탁드립니다."

Machinable Language (기계의 언어)

  • 목적: AI Agent의 자율 실행
  • 특징: 맥락 독립적, 명시적 의미, 즉시 실행 가능
  • 예:

json

{
 "measurement": 
   {"type": "temperature", "value": 255, "status": "warning"
   },  "action": 
   {"type": "inspect", "target": "coolant", "deadline":   
    "18:00"}
}

한 문장 정의

Machinable Language는 AI Agent가 사람의 개입 없이 데이터를 이해하고 즉시 행동할 수 있도록 의미, 관계, 추론 규칙, 실행 지시를 명시적으로 포함한 구조화된 데이터 표현 언어이다.

 


AI 시대, 데이터를 보는 관점이 완전히 바뀐다, 바꿔야 한다.

https://www.gnict.org/blog/130/%EA%B8%80/ai-%EC%8B%9C%EB%8C%80-%EB%8D%B0%EC%9D%B4%ED%84%B0%EB%A5%BC-%EB%B3%B4%EB%8A%94-%EA%B4%80%EC%A0%90%EC%9D%B4-%EC%99%84%EC%A0%84%ED%9E%88-%EB%B0%94%EB%80%90%EB%8B%A4-%EB%B0%94%EA%BF%94%EC%95%BC-%ED%95%9C%EB%8B%A4/?prevurl=/blog/130/

 

 

기업 홍보를 위한 확실한 방법
협회 홈페이지에 회사정보를 보강해 보세요.